Codorniu is the oldest wine and cava producer in Spain, and today we are joining a tour of their winemaking facilities.

How old is Codorniu?
Codorniu goes back to the 16th century. Miquel Reventos and Anna Codorniu were part of wine growing families. In 1658 they married and Anna Codorniu took Miquel's surname, however, Anna's surname became the name of this famous international brand, Codorniu.

How is Cava Made?
Cava is made using a traditional method called "Methods Champenoise". This is a two stage process, and the key to this method is the secondary fermentation in the bottle, with yeast and sugar. This stage then produces bubbles creating what we all know as sparkling wine.

Where Can I do a Tour of Codorniu?
The main facilities are located in Barcelona, Spain. A tour usually lasts around 105 minutes, with a special cava testing at the end, however, there are different packs that can suit your desired experience.
